Code U1325 Nissan Description

The Diagnostic Trouble Code (DTC) sets when the calibration of Automatic Back Door position information work is not successful.

What are the Possible Causes of the DTC U1325 Nissan?

  • Configuration work of Automatic Back Door Control Module
  • Faulty Automatic Back Door Control Module

How to Fix the DTC U1325 Nissan?

Review the 'Possible Causes' above and visually examine the corresponding wiring harness and connectors. Check for damaged components and inspect connector pins for signs of being bro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ded.

What is the Cost to Diagnose the Code?

Labor: 1.0

To diagnose the U1325 Nissan code, it typically requires 1.0 hour of labor. Rates vary by location, vehicle, and shop. Many shops charge between $80–$150 per hour; dealerships and metro areas may be higher, independents may be lower.

Frequently Asked Questions about U1325 Nissan Code

1. What are the common symptoms of a U1325 OBDII code related to the Automatic Back Door Control Module Calibration in a Nissan?

The common symptoms include issues with the automatic back door function, such as failure to open or close properly, erratic behavior, or in some cases, total malfunction.

2. What can cause the U1325 OBDII code to trigger in a Nissan vehicle?

The U1325 code can be triggered by a fault in the Automatic Back Door Control Module, a calibration error, wiring issues, or a malfunction in the back door motor or sensors.

3. How serious is a U1325 OBDII code in a Nissan?

While the U1325 code may not affect the overall drivability of the vehicle, it can cause inconvenience and safety concerns due to the automatic back door not functioning as intended.

4. How can I diagnose a U1325 OBDII code related to the Automatic Back Door in my Nissan?

Diagnosing the U1325 code involves using a diagnostic scanner to read the code, inspecting the back door components, checking the wiring for any damage, and performing a calibration of the Automatic Back Door Control Module.

5. Can I repair a U1325 OBDII code in my Nissan at home?

Depending on the cause of the U1325 code, some repairs can be done at home, such as checking and repairing wiring issues. However, calibration of the Automatic Back Door Control Module may require professional equipment.

6. What are some tips for repairing a U1325 OBDII code in a Nissan?

Ensure all wiring connections related to the back door system are secure, inspect for any visible damage, reset the code after repairs, and perform a calibration of the Automatic Back Door Control Module if necessary.
